Lex Luthor Cameo, Nazi Twist, No Superman Explained

The latest episode of “Peacemaker” has left fans reeling with a major plot twist that reveals an alternate Earth where Nazi Germany won World War II. In Season 2, Episode 6, titled “Ignorance Is Chris,” the 11th Street Kids team ventures into this alternate reality to bring their Peacemaker back home, only to discover a horrifying truth.

The episode delves into the alternate world where Christopher Smith, aka Peacemaker, is living a seemingly perfect life with his family of superheroes. However, as the team explores this universe, they begin to notice unsettling details. Harcourt realizes the lack of diversity in the town, while Vigilante encounters his doppelgänger who sees Peacemaker as his archenemy. Adebayo and Economos face a terrifying encounter with a mob of Nazi Americans, highlighting the dark reality of this Earth.

As Peacemaker and Harcourt uncover the truth behind the American flags adorned with swastikas at alt-A.R.G.U.S., the shocking reality of Nazi rule on Earth X is revealed. Creator and director James Gunn kept this twist under wraps, testing viewers’ attention to detail by subtly hinting at the lack of diversity in the alternate world.

As the creator of the show, James Gunn provides insight into the thought processes behind the latest episodes of “Peacemaker.” While the show is not intended to make political statements, real-world events inevitably influence the storytelling. Gunn emphasizes that the core of the show lies within the relationships between the characters, particularly the 11th Street Kids and their dynamic evolution throughout the series.

The upcoming episode promises to delve deeper into the complexities of Earth X, challenging viewers to consider alternate perspectives and moral dilemmas. The introduction of characters like Lex Luthor adds a new dimension to the narrative, setting the stage for future developments in the DC Universe.

Despite the interconnected nature of the DCU, Gunn clarifies that Earth X will not be a central focus moving forward. Instead, the focus remains on the character of Peacemaker and the internal struggles he faces.
